The term unremarkable is often used by physicians, lab technicians or radiologists to suggest that the results of a test or scan does not differ from what they would expect to see on a normal test. The working definition of "grossly unremarkable" (from Stedman's Medical Dictionary, Dorland's Medical Reference, and others) is: "Gross examination (general outline examination) revealing no abnormality that can be remarked (stated)." In other words normal or average findings with no urgent intervention needed.
